An epigraph is a quotation, poem or a phrase at the beginning of a document or a story which serves to present a preface, summary or sometimes even a counter example or to link the work to a broader perspective. Predicate pronoun

A predicate pronoun is any pronoun that is part of the predicate.

A predicate is the part of a sentence that includes the verb and the words following it that relate to that verb.

Examples:

I will call him .

The teacher gave us a history assignment.

Mother made lunch for them .

A sentence may have more than one predicate; for example:

Mother made lunch for them and set it on the picnic table.

A subjective pronoun can be part of a predicate when it is the subject of a clause,; for example:

Mary brought a cake she made for the party .

A subjective pronoun is also used as a subject complement when it follows a linking verb; for example:

The leaders right now are he and I .
